Examining Table
A piece of equipment in healthcare settings designed for patients to sit or lie on during medical examinations or procedures.
Biohazardous Waste Container
A leakproof, puncture-resistant container, color-coded red or labeled with a biohazard symbol, that is used to store and dispose of contaminated supplies and equipment.
Paper Coverings
Disposable sheets or covers, often used in medical settings to maintain hygiene and prevent cross-contamination.
Body Fluids
Liquids within humans and other living organisms that include blood, saliva, semen, and lymph, responsible for transporting nutrients, oxygen, and waste products.
